Reuters exclusively reveals Chile copper output growth to slow as mining projects face delays

Citing an unpublished report, Reuters exclusively reported that Chile’s mining regulator Cochilco was forecasting far slower growth in copper production over the next decade than previously estimated, with peak output two years later than anticipated and at a significantly lower level. Reuters reveals Qatar Investment Authority raises stake in Credit Suisse to just under 7%

Reuters revealed Qatar’s sovereign wealth fund has increased its stake in Credit Suisse to just under 7%, becoming the Swiss bank’s second-largest shareholder after Saudi National Bank, signaling that its Gulf investor base is growing in importance. Reuters reveals Southwest CEO says all options ‘on the table’ after carrier’s meltdown, and vows responsibility

Reuters exclusively revealed that Southwest Airlines Co Chief Executive Bob Jordan is looking at all options to ensure the operational meltdown the company suffered last month is not repeated.
